Features:
  • Adjustable green 20 millimeter nylon strap fits up to 8-inch wrist circumference
  • Cream dial with date window at 3 o'clock; Full Arabic numerals
  • Black 40 millimeter brass case with mineral glass crystal
  • Indiglo light-up watch dial; luminous hands
  • Water resistant to 50 meters (165 feet)

I worked outside in the heat for years wearing these Timex watches and the strap is a nice feature because its strong doesn't get all slimy like the rubber straps.
I have a Garmin Fenix watch and stopped wearing it because I dont like the slip-slimy bands.
I also hate hitting a button that send the watch into a function I didn't know how to get out of after not reading instructions for a year
